Output 5dc912625c8cc105701860a0b4b95446cfb72f16b6ec6e7d36a3b8e9b165e456:2

value
169440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ce12b3920b5622009774ef988bd719db266dae4 OP_EQUAL
address
37EvD4NMadr4oPDrtLtkkG3bXWkd6VxYd6
transaction
5dc912625c8cc105701860a0b4b95446cfb72f16b6ec6e7d36a3b8e9b165e456
confirmations
281952
spent
true